Default ActivePrinter in Excel changes!

During a long running excel macro that also sets page margins and headers, I
set the activeprinter at the start of the macro but it changes dynamically if
the system default printer changes during the macro's execution. This causes
the macro to fail. Is there some property that can be set to not allow the
activeprinter to be changed? The biggest problem occurs on terminal services
when a user logs off and are left without any default printer assignment
which causes excel to prompt for one. My macro runs unattended so it just
hangs waiting for user input.
